India coronavirus, COVID-19 live updates, June 3: Andhra Pradesh reports 79 new COVID-19 cases, total tally at 3279
India’s total of COVID-19 cases rose to 2,07,615 including 1,01,497 active cases, 100,303 cured and 5,815 deaths with 8,909 new COVID-19 cases and 217 deaths in the last 24 hours, the Union Ministry of Health and Family Welfare informed on Wednesday.
The recovery rate reached 48.19% amongst coronavirus patients, the health ministry said.
India on Tuesday became the world’s seventh country to register more than 2 lakh COVID-19 cases just a fortnight after crossing the 1-lakh mark, with over 8,000 fresh infections and 219 deaths reported due to the virus.
Meanwhile, Prime Minister Narendra Modi addressing the Confederation of Indian Industry (CII) Annual Session 2020 on Tuesday said, “World is looking for a trusted, reliable partner; India has potential, strength, ability. India now needs to manufacture products that are made in India but made for the world.”
PM Modi said that strengthening the economy is one of the top priorities alongside fighting coronavirus.
